HomeMy WebLinkAboutMINUTES - 09152009 - C.34RECOMMENDATION(S): Approve and authorize the Health Services Director or his designee (Wendel Brunner, M.D.), to execute, on behalf of the County, Interagency Agreement #28-704-7 (#10-033) with First 5 Contra Costa Children and Families Commission, to pay the County an amount not to exceed $242,050 for the Tobacco Education Project “Promoting Smoke Free Families”, for the period from July 1, 2009 through June 30, 2010. FISCAL IMPACT: Approval of this Agreement will result in $242,050 from the Contra Costa Children and Families Commission for the Tobacco Education Project. No County funds are required. BACKGROUND: The Contra Costa Children & Families Commission, in collaboration with the County's Family, Maternal and Child Health Programs will coordinate and administer the Tobacco Education Project to support healthy home and community environments free of tobacco smoke and substance abuse by family members. On August 19, 2008, the Board of Supervisors approved Contract #28-704-6 with First 5 Contra Costa Children & Families Commission, for the period from July 1, 2008 through June 30, 2009. Approval of this Agreement #28-704-7 will allow the County to continue the Tobacco Education Project, through June 30, 2010.
